Ashram Road takes its name from Mahatma Gandhi's Sabarmati Ashram, which stands at its northern end and is one of the most visited heritage landmarks in Gujarat. Hotel Volga's position on this arterial road places it within straightforward reach of Ahmedabad's central business district, major banks and financial institutions, and government offices — many of which are clustered along or just off Ashram Road itself. The area is well served by the Ahmedabad BRTS (Bus Rapid Transit System) network, and Ahmedabad Junction railway station and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el International Airport are both accessible from this corridor. For delegates driving in, Ashram Road's connectivity to the wider city road network reduces travel time from most parts of Ahmedabad. Conference halls of this type within hotel properties generally support multiple seating configurations, including theatre style, classroom, boardroom, hollow square, and U-shape. The right layout depends on the nature of the event — for instance, a training workshop may favour classroom style, while a board meeting typically uses a boardroom or U-shape setup.
